South Africa’s Supreme Court of Appeal grilled Oscar Pistorius’ attorney and a prosecutor as it weighed whether to convict him of murder for killing his girlfriend, uphold a lower court’s manslaughter conviction or order a retrial.

Prosecutors say the North Gauteng High Court erred in convicting Pistorius of the lesser charge, saying that he should have known that someone could be killed when he fired four times into a locked toilet cubicle in his home.

In the trial last year, prosecutors said Pistorius killed Reeva Steenkamp as she sought shelter during an argument on Valentine’s Day 2013.
